Application
meso-23-Dimercaptosuccinic acid (DMSA) has been used to form a monolayer on MgTiAu micromotors to enhance the chelation of toxic heavy metal contaminants (Zn(II) Cd(II) and Pb(II)) from polluted aqueous solutions. It can be used As a reducing and stabilizing agent to synthesize monolayer-protected gold clusters For terminal carboxylation of the oleylamine coated Fe3O4 nanoparticles to develop targeted curcumin drug delivery system

General Description
Dimercaptosuccinic acid (DMSA) also called succimer is the organosulfur compound with the formula HO2CCH(SH)CH(SH)CO2H. This colorless solid contains two carboxylic acid and two thiol groups the latter being responsible for its mildly unpleasant odour. It occurs in two diastereomers meso and the chiral dl forms. The meso isomer is used as a chelating agent for treatment of heavy metal toxicity and is a water-soluble and non-toxic substance. When radiolabeled with technetium-99m it helps in diagnostic testing of renal function.
